Oregon Statutes - Chapter 109 - Parent and Child Rights and Relationships - Section 109.824 - Role of law enforcement officer.

At the request of a district attorney acting under ORS 109.821, a law enforcement officer may take any lawful action reasonably necessary to locate a child or a party and assist a district attorney with responsibilities under ORS 109.821. [1999 c.649 §38]
